Guess what? The Steelers are not going to sign Cam Newton

Every time there is a veteran quarterback looking for work, the media pounces on the story and tries to push the narrative toward the Pittsburgh Steelers. First it was Jameis Winston, then briefly Andy Dalton. Now with both of them off the market the media has now circled back around to Cam Newton.

This must stop.

Joy Taylor and Colin Cowherd discussed the idea on The Herd and Taylor was adamant that if Newton is going to sign somewhere, it needs to the with the Steelers.

I’m sure there is a huge percentage of the fanbase who would love to see the Steelers add a veteran backup quarterback. But the front office has said over and over this offseason, Mason Rudolph is the backup quarterback and they don’t plan to disrupt the depth chart.
